WebThe rectangular representation of a complex number is in the form z = a + bi. If you were to represent a complex number according to its Cartesian Coordinates, it would be in the form: (a, b); where a, the real part, lies along the x axis and the imaginary part, b, along the y axis. The Polar Coordinates of a a complex number is in the form (r, θ). If you want to … WebAny complex number is then an expression of the form a+ bi, where aand bare old-fashioned real numbers. The number ais called the real part of a+bi, and bis called its imaginary part. Traditionally the letters zand ware used to stand for complex numbers.
